Chaps is short for chaparero. Protection from chaparel, a very tough and thorny plant in the southwest that is impossible to ride through without protection. Vaqueros and or cowboys would rig leather similar leather gaurds for their horses.

A friend of mine was a cowboy in north Texas. He was working on his father's ranch somewhere near Amarillo. One day he got out of the truck to open a cattle gate and got struck by a Western Diamondback. He was wearing a set of Bullhide Shotgun Chaps and fortunately the snake's fangs did not penetrate the hide. So, he was lucky. However, he did say, those big snakes hit hard.

"Chaps are intended to protect the legs of cowboys from contact with daily environmental hazards seen in working with cattle, horses and other livestock. They help to protect riders' legs from scraping on brush, injury from thorns of cacti, sagebrush, mesquite and other thorny vegetation"
